Senior Scientist
Jan 2024 — Present · Bedford, MA, US
Oversee the generation of immunogen and positive control for ADA at CROs.• Independently develop ADA testing methods and transfer to CROs to support qualification/validation of methods according to the regulatory guidance.• Manage CROs for implementing ADA assays for testing samples from non-clinical and clinical studies.• Review study protocols, manage critical reagent lots, and monitor GLP sample testing.• Develop analytical assays to quantitate oligonucleotides in biological matrices to understand absorption, metabolism, distribution, and excretion (ADME) of drug candidates.• As subject matter expert in analytical assays, help CROs in troubleshooting any potential issues.• Design and develop biomarker assays to support identification of PD and potential clinical safety biomarkers in collaboration with toxicologist. Help in pharmacokinetic (PK)/toxicokinetic analysis of preclinical studies.• Present results at cross-functional teams and lab meetings.• Maintain accurate documentation of experiments in Electronic Laboratory Notebook (ELN).• Prepare high quality reports from internal or external projects (as needed).• Help maintain the bioanalytical lab operations and facilitate the timely renewal of service contracts by working closely with lab scientists and facility managers.• May manages a direct report.• Author/review scientific reports.
